Mount Charles in pole position with three year NW200 contract

Leading food service and business support firm Mount Charles has won a significant contract with one of the country's largest outdoor sporting events, the Vauxhall International North West 200.

Mount Charles, which recently qualified as one of Ireland’s Best Managed Companies for the seventh year running, will deliver bar and beverage services to tens of thousands of people within the North West 200 hospitality tent over the next three years.

“We are actively focusing on growing our business in the outside events space, both in terms of bar/beverage services and event catering,” said chairman Trevor Annon.

“This contract with the North West 200, an event of significant scale and importance to the local economy, is a strategic win that will help us further build our presence and reputation in this competitive marketplace, and we look forward to building our relationship with Mervyn and the team over the coming three years and beyond.

“This is a further string to our bow and adds to the impact we have already had in the outdoor events arena with high profile partnerships with organisations including Ulster Rugby, Digital DNA and the Down Royal Racecourse,” he said.

Mervyn Whyte, Event Director added: “The NW200 is extremely proud of the Vauxhall’s marquee reputation for providing quality food, excellent hospitality and memorable entertainment.

“I am delighted that Mount Charles, with their renowned expertise in the provision of quality dining and bar services, will be partnering the Vauxhall International North West 200,” he said.
